What's in Gale eBooks library database?

The Gale eBooks library database has reference materials, such as encyclopedias, dictionaries, and handbooks, which are credible, published resources to use for defining key concepts and movements. 

Start searching the Gale eBooks library database:

Search tips & sample search:

  1. In the search box at the top, start by typing in keywords that relate to your key concepts, community, etc. For keywords that are a phrase, then put those words in quotation marks. This keeps those words together in your search results, and leads to more relevant results.
  2. Click on the title of the article to read the full article -- and get extra tools to help you email and cite the article!
  3. Take note of the title of the encyclopedia or reference book -- this will give you clues about the subject matter or context
  4. Take note of the publication datepage count, and document type.
  5. Also pay attention to different ways you can filter, or narrow down, your results. For sources that define key concepts, click the "Document Type" button and select the "Topic overview."
  6. Click the Topic Finder button to visually narrow down your keywords and results
